They’d perhaps not amount brand new bills getting paid down on your own DTI ratio. They would underwrite the borrowed funds because if the individuals debts try zero (while they is). They amount your first-mortgage plus the percentage for the newest 2nd. There are more expenses measured (child help/alimony) however, that needs to be it.
Almost certainly the greater issue is one to providers money losings. They often averge the prior a couple of years out-of Taxable (schedule C) money, and frequently have fun with good YTD P&L statement, and also for of numerous thinking-working people who is the contract breaker. For example, in the event your year just before this past year their nonexempt schedule C money are $100,000, but last year you showed a loss of $100,000, your income to own underwriting would be no. They don’t count tax refunds and/or worth of assets and you can discounts. They merely amount the funds/returns out of your expenditures/offers that appear on your tax returns.
I would personally reach out to your loan administrator and have directly. Ask what ratios he’s got calculated. Often the better proportion would-be your current first mortgage, plus second “back-end” proportion will be the first mortgage therefore the the brand new 2nd mortgage. The front ratio comes with fees/insurance/hoa costs.
